دانلود با لینک مستقیم و پر سرعت .
پاورپوینت لیست های پیوندی در 112 اسلاید بسیار جامع و کامل شامل بخش های زیر می باشد:
تعریف لیست پیوندی :Link List
نقایص کار با آرایه ها به صورت ترتیبی
پر هزینه بودن اضافه کردن عنصر
راه حل مشکلات ناشی از کار با آرایه به صورت ترتیبی
- عملیات لیست پیوندی
پیاده سازی لیست پیوندی به وسیله ی آرایه
درج در لیست پیوندی
مراحل درج در لیست پیوندی
پیاده سازی با اشاره گر
روش های طراحی لیست
روش های طراحی لیست
طراحی لیست به وسیله ی کلاس مدیر
دستکاری اشاره گرها در C++
مثال – ایجاد لیست با دو گره
یک کلاس لیست پیوندی با قابلیت استفاده مجدد
تعریف لیست های با قابلیت استفاده ی مجدد
عملکردها روی لیست پیوندی
اضافه کردن عنصر جدید
اضافه کردن به ابتدای لیست
حذف عنصر از ابتدای لیست پیوندی
لیست های حلقوی
عملکردهای لیست حلقوی
نمایش لیست حلقوی
اضافه کردن عنصر جدید
پشته های پیوندی
تعریف کلاس پشته
درج در پشته
حذف از پشته
صف های پیوندی
تعریف کلاس صف پیوندی
اضافه کردن عنصر جدید به صف پیوندی- درج در انتها
لیست های پیوندی دوگانه
انواع لیست های پیوندی دوگانه
اضافه کردن عنصر به لیست دوطرفه ساده
اضافه کردن عنصر به لیست دوطرفه ساده
حذف از لیست دوطرفه
چند جمله ای ها
تعریف لیست پیوندی :Link List
تعریف : مجموعه ای از گره ها که هرگره حداقل شامل یک فیلد داده ویک فیلد اشاره گر است.
اشاره گر هر گره از نوع خود گره است.
هر گره به وسیله ی اشاره گر خود به گره بعدی اشاره می کند.
نقایص کار با آرایه ها به صورت ترتیبی
بازگشت ناپذیر بودن حافظه بعد از گرفتن آن
لازم بودن پیش بینی بیشترین حافظه مورد نیاز
پر هزینه بودن اضافه کردن عنصر
پر هزینه بودن حذف کردن عنصر
پر هزینه بودن اضافه کردن عنصر
می خواهیم C را به آن اضافه کنیم به طوری که ترتیب آن الفبایی بماند.
...
.
.
.
پیاده سازی لیست پیوندی به وسیله ی آرایه
lبرای ایجاد این لیست باید از دو آرایه استفاده کرد.
lآرایه ی اول برای داده ها : این آرایه از نوع داده ی مورد نظر انتخاب می شود (مثلا یک structure)
lآرایه ی دوم برای اتصال ها : این آرایه که از نوع int است.متناظر با داده هاست.که نشان دهنده ی آدرس داده بعدی است....